Field experiences are integrated throughout the teacher preparation program. The field-based undergraduate and graduate programs are offered at the Pullman, Tri-Cities and Vancouver campuses. Placements are made in those areas as well as in Spokane and Greater Puget Sound. Student teaching may also be arranged internationally in Europe and Asia.
Undergraduate programs include some field experiences prior to program admission. Upon admission, field experiences are integrated with blocked methods courses and vary in design depending on the campus. Sixteen weeks of student teaching is the culminating experience.
Graduate programs leading to licensure include Master in Teaching offered at the Pullman/Spokane, Tri-Cities and Vancouver campuses for elementary and some content area endorsements. Programs vary in length depending on the campus.
